Dads participate in skin-to-skin contact with their newborns to promote bonding, help regulate the baby's body temperature, heart rate, and breathing, and reduce stress for both the baby and themselves. This is otherwise known as Kangaroo care. https://www.scientificamerican.com/article/why-dads-and-their-babies-need-to-go-skin-to-skin1/#:~:text=Soon%20after%20a%20baby%20is,warmth%20and%20security%20to%20babies.
